World War II. Tea Leaf Annie follows one young girl's memories of the 1940's. It was a different time - a red, white and blue era where citizens pulled together to support the United States of America. Young men went to war, many to become honored by a gold star on a banner in the window of a home of a family with broken hearts. The author relates her memories of the upheaval in her own home and her everyday life, prewar and post war. It is the story of thousands of children no matter where they fell geographically. These recollections were formed in two sections of a small Massachusetts town, North and West Chelmsford, but were much the same across the country. Her father did not have to go due to his age, he was married and had a child. But he was firm about his need to leave and with his experience at the local lumber company joined a Naval Construction Battalion, the CB's. He left behind a bewildered little girl, "Why Daddy, Why?"
